span8号
第4排
嗨,我正在尝试运行此post请求,但它没有正确传递参数,有人能提出我做错了什么吗?我先尝试邮递员,然后将其更改为在SQL Server中工作
谢谢你
post/fmerest/v3/transformations/transactiodata/office_tasks/rock_property_to_team.fmw?fmetoken=41544e72aac7b3da0b9095eac0c23120b6d97 http/1.1
内容类型:application/json
缓存控制:无缓存
“PublishedParameters”:。[
“name”:“file_path”,“value”:“rock_properties_upload_test1.xlsx”
}
您好!@奥利弗莫里斯post/fmerest/v3/transformations/transactionData端点需要文件作为主体,而不是包含文件名的已发布参数:
https://docs.亚搏在线safe.com/fme/html/fme_rest/apidoc/v3/index.html_!/转换/后-后-24
如果要提交具有某些已发布参数的作业,请查看以下端点:
post/transforms/transact/<repository>/<workspace>
发布/转换/提交/<repository>/<workspace>
“传递参数不正确”究竟是什么意思?作业日志对此参数有何说明?
谢谢你的帮助,大卫,
我只是得到:
{
“timerequested”:“2019-01-28t17:02:57z”,
“请求结果端口”:45111,
“NumFeaturesOutput”:0,
“requesterhost”:“10.0.0.81”,
“TimeStarted”:“2019-01-28t17:02:57z”,
“ID”:325729,
“timefinished”:“2019-01-28t17:02:58z”,
“优先级”:-1,
“statusMessage”:“java.nio.file.directorynotemptyexception:/data/fmeserver/resources/temp/geochem/office_loader”,
“status”:“FME_故障”
}
它基本上告诉我它正在创建一个文件,其中一个文件夹当前(从上一次运行中)它试图创建一个文件的原因是参数没有包含在日志中。
不过,我用fme-server-restapi网页界面运行它,它很好,显示在发布的参数中。
这与身体有关,当我使用默认值时,没有身体,它就可以正常工作。
{
“timerequested”:“2019-01-28t16:33:33z”,
“请求结果端口”:46477,
“numFeaturesOutput”:16510,
“requesterhost”:“10.0.0.81”,
“TimeStarted”:“2019-01-28t16:33:33z”,
“ID”:325702,
“timefinished”:“2019-01-28t16:34:12z”,
“优先级”:-1,
“statusMessage”:“翻译成功”,
“status”:“成功”
}
?2019安全亚搏在线软件公司|法律